Output e0664618a0a5305fcbaa23eeacf4d6e035ac2435acaf82aeb648c39a9c772a97:1

value
6730288
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d661b1a10ed2cdeb473a6f32fd5ff2274020c45 OP_EQUALVERIFY OP_CHECKSIG
address
1MBeeqQFzs1LWxm5wsJRY6wzw7K7CPrHB6
transaction
e0664618a0a5305fcbaa23eeacf4d6e035ac2435acaf82aeb648c39a9c772a97
spent
true